    US Coast Guardsmen provide safer waters at Midway Atoll [Image 2 of 4]

    US Coast Guardsmen provide safer waters at Midway Atoll

    MIDWAY ATOLL, HI, UNITED STATES

    09.02.2014

    Photo by Staff Sgt. Christopher Hubenthal 

    DMA Pacific - Hawaii Media Bureau   

    U.S. Coast Guard Seaman Jake Thomas assigned to the U.S. Coast Guard Cutter Kakui, applies cleaner, lubricant and preservative to rigging chains fastened to buoys during an aids to navigation mission Sept. 2, 2014, at Midway Atoll, Hawaii. The Coast Guard crew of the Kakui inspected, maintained or replaced 12 buoys during the mission. Buoys need to be inspected every two years and need to replaced every six years.
